LURIA-MANZANO, Ricardo; AGUILAR-LOPEZ, José Luis; CANSECO-MARQUEZ, Luis e GUTIERREZ-MAYEN, María Guadalupe. Geographic distribution of Anotheca spinosa (Anura: Hylidae) in México: new record for the amphibian fauna of Puebla. Rev. Mex. Biodiv. [online]. 2014, vol.85, n.4, pp.1285-1288. ISSN 2007-8706. https://doi.org/10.7550/rmb.47475.
Based on field work at different localities, we provide new data on the geographic distribution of the arboreal frog Anotheca spinosa in Mexico, which fill gaps in the previously known distribution. The discovery of this species in southeastern Puebla represents the first record for the state. The distribution of this frog in Mexico is more extensive and continuous than previously known.
